Let’s talk about the “fridge hack” 👇🏻 • typically you will want to place your flanges and bottles in something clean like a gallon size plastic bag before placing them in the fridge • if using this hack you do NOT rinse the parts before placing them in the fridge  • sanitizing the pump parts and bottles at the end of the day would be recommended if using this hack  • you only place the bottles and flanges in the fridge - NOT the pump motor • I would not recommend this hack if your baby is immunocompromised or under two months old! I totally understand how convenient the fridge hack can be, especially when pumping at work! I would highly recommend deep cleaning/sanitizing your pump parts after using this hack to make sure they get cleaned thoroughly!
